  13. 25 minutes ago, handofthesly said:

    In the Main menu there’s the Editor option, once you’re in this mode go to File and then open the save file. Find the dead body, click on it, and then press delete. Save the game and exit back to main menu. Continue the game as you would normally, don’t click the file with the icons in the corner as this will open the save in editor mode again.
